The dataset represents the waste management activities of \"municipal solid waste\" in a sanitary landfill. The recommended use of this dataset: for average municipal/public waste mixtures. It is not suitable to represent any single specific waste, such as plastic, paper, cardboard. The characteristics of municipal solid waste in Ya'an city, Sichuan Province are as follows: food waste 50.09%, paper 15.54%, rubber 12.63%, textile (fiber) 2.34%, wood and bamboo 7.78%, ash and soil 0.32%, bricks, tiles and ceramics 1.42%, glass 0.09%, metal 0.8%, other 0%. Moisture 64. 86%, higher heating value 5930.68 kJ/kg, lower heating value 4117.5 kJ/kg. The carbon share from initial waste, i.e., 60.4% biogenic carbon. The unoxidized and largely recoverable metal proportion in waste (excluding very small or very thin components): Iron: 60.03%; Aluminum: 17.81%; Copper: 72.83%. Overall degradation rate of waste over 100 years: 18.73%. Degradability of waste fractions: Paper: 27%; Mixed cardboard: 32. 4% plastic: 1%; laminated materials: 18%; laminated packaging, such as drink cartons: 18%; combined products, such as diapers: 18%; glass: 0%; textiles: 12%; minerals: 0%; natural products: 27%; compostable materials: 27%; inert metals: 10%; volatile metals: 0%; batteries: 0%; electronics: 0%; landfill gas capture and utilization generate 2.09E-04 kWh of electricity and 7.51E-01 MJ of useful heat.
